Roles:
  • Biotechnologist: Biotechnologists work on developing new technologies to improve crop yields and resistance to pests and diseases.
  • Agronomist: Agronomists study crops and soil to improve farming practices and crop yields, often working in collaboration with biotechnologists.
  • Research Scientist: Research scientists conduct experiments and analyze data to develop new agricultural technologies and practices.
  • Field Trial Coordinator: Coordinators plan and oversee field trials of new agricultural technologies, ensuring that they meet regulatory requirements.
  • Policy Advisor: Policy advisors develop and promote policies that support the adoption of new agricultural technologies and practices.
  • Public Engagement Specialist: Specialists communicate the benefits of new agricultural technologies to the public, often through educational programs and media outreach.
